Data is often organized into tables and then into graphs to enhance clarity and facilitate analysis. Tables provide a structured format that allows for easy comparison and detailed examination of individual data points. Graphs visually represent this data, making trends, patterns, and relationships more immediately apparent, which aids in interpretation and communication of findings. Together, they enable more effective decision-making and insights.

Two or more tables containing duplicate data exemplify a normalization issue in a database design. This scenario often arises from poor data organization, leading to redundancy and potential inconsistencies. To resolve this, database normalization techniques can be applied to eliminate duplicates and ensure data integrity across the tables.
